Lack of Licensing Information

When evaluating the legitimacy of an online casino, it’s crucial to check for licensing information. A lack of licensing details should be a cause for concern for players. Reputable online casinos typically display their licensing information prominently on their websites, showing that they operate under the oversight of recognized regulatory authorities. A valid license ensures that the casino complies with industry laws and regulations, offering players a level of protection.

Without proper licensing, there’s a risk of encountering unfair gameplay, potential security breaches of personal information, and mishandling of funds. Delayed or Nonexistent Payouts

Players may encounter frustration and disappointment when payouts from online casinos are delayed or not received. To prevent such issues, it’s important to be aware of potential warning signs:

  1. Excessive Verification Requirements: Casinos that repeatedly ask for more documentation before processing payouts may be causing delays intentionally.

  2. Unclear Terms and Conditions: Complex or ambiguous payout procedures could indicate possible payment delays or complications.

  3. Unresponsive Customer Support: Difficulty in obtaining clear information or timelines regarding payouts from customer service could be a red flag.

  4. History of Payment Complaints: Researching the casino online for past disputes related to delayed or missing payouts can offer insights into their reliability.

Suspicious Terms and Conditions

When engaging in online gambling, it’s crucial to pay close attention to the terms and conditions set by casinos, as they can significantly impact your gaming experience. Here are some important points to consider:

  1. Unclear Bonus Terms: Ambiguous or overly complex bonus terms could indicate that a casino is aiming to make it challenging for players to withdraw their winnings. It’s essential to fully understand the bonus conditions before committing to them.

  2. Excessive Withdrawal Restrictions: Casinos that impose unreasonable limits on withdrawal amounts or frequency may not prioritize the players’ best interests. It’s advisable to choose casinos that offer fair and transparent withdrawal policies.

  3. Unreasonable Wagering Requirements: High wagering requirements can make it difficult for players to meet the conditions for cashing out their winnings. It’s recommended to opt for casinos with reasonable wagering requirements to enhance the chances of withdrawing winnings.

  4. Hidden Fees and Charges: Some casinos may include hidden fees or charges in their terms and conditions, impacting the overall profitability of gaming activities. Players should carefully review the terms to identify any hidden costs that could diminish their winnings.
